GCC Chia Seed Market Outlooks
Chia seeds (Salvia hispanica) are tiny, nutrient-dense edible seeds widely recognized as a superfood for their high levels of fiber, omega-3 fatty acids, protein, antioxidants, and essential minerals. They are commonly used in smoothies, breakfast bowls, puddings, baked goods, and beverages because they absorb liquid and form a gel-like texture, making them popular for weight management and digestive health.
In the GCC region, including Saudi Arabia, the United Arab Emirates, Kuwait, Qatar, Oman, and Bahrain, chia seeds have gained significant popularity as consumers increasingly adopt healthy, organic, and plant-based diets. The rise of fitness culture, wellness trends, and the rising prevalence of lifestyle diseases has further boosted demand across supermarkets, health stores, and online platforms. Their versatility, long shelf life, and ease of incorporation into traditional and modern recipes continue to drive their adoption among health-conscious consumers across the region. Retail expansion, influencer marketing, and increased availability through e-commerce platforms have also strengthened chia seed awareness and consumption across urban populations in GCC countries in recent years, steadily growing now.
Obesity Prevalence by GCC Country in 2025
Saudi Arabia
Saudi Arabia records an adult obesity prevalence of around 35.4%, reflecting a continued rise driven by sedentary lifestyles, dietary changes, and urbanization trends.
United Arab Emirates (UAE)
The UAE shows an obesity prevalence of approximately 31.7%, influenced by high-income lifestyles, reduced physical activity, and growing consumption of processed foods.
Kuwait
Kuwait has one of the highest rates in the GCC at about 37.9%, placing it among the most obese nations globally.
Qatar
Qatar's obesity prevalence is around 35.1%, with strong links to urban lifestyle patterns and dietary shifts.
Bahrain
Bahrain reports an obesity rate of approximately 29.8%, slightly lower than its GCC peers but still significantly above global averages.
Oman
Oman has the lowest obesity prevalence in the GCC at about 27%-30%, though rates are rising with increasing urbanization.
Sources: Datapandas.Org

Challenges of the GCC Chia Seed Market
High Import Dependency and Price Volatility
One of the key challenges facing the GCC chia seed market is its heavy reliance on imports, primarily from Latin American countries where chia is extensively cultivated. Since the region lacks large-scale domestic production due to unsuitable climatic conditions, supply chains are vulnerable to global disruptions. Factors such as fluctuating international crop yields, transportation costs, and currency exchange rates directly impact pricing. As a result, chia seeds often remain relatively expensive compared to other dietary supplements or local superfoods. This price sensitivity can limit adoption among middle-income consumers in the GCC. Additionally, any disruption in global trade routes or export restrictions from producing countries can create supply shortages. These uncertainties make it difficult for retailers and distributors to maintain stable pricing, affecting long-term market growth potential and consumer purchasing consistency.

GCC Milled/Ground Chia Seed Market
Milled or ground chia seeds (Chia seed) are gaining traction in the GCC due to their improved digestibility and ease of incorporation into various food applications. Unlike whole seeds, ground chia is more readily absorbed by the body, making it attractive for consumers seeking enhanced nutritional benefits. It is widely used in bakery products, smoothies, protein shakes, infant nutrition, and fortified foods where a smoother texture is required. The fine consistency allows manufacturers to blend it seamlessly into processed foods without altering taste or texture significantly. However, ground chia has a shorter shelf life due to faster oxidation of oils, requiring careful storage and supply chain management. Despite this limitation, rising demand for convenience foods and functional ingredients is driving steady adoption. Food processors and health brands in the GCC are increasingly investing in milled chia-based formulations to cater to evolving consumer preferences for ready-to-use nutrition solutions.
